Output 17a4bffdfd4e4b82184fd121c620157c251b137fa842811bc3030ee3bf798f01:1

value
39170688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d26cb9a4860fd14a1e07a2b06d607d9ea23c6e OP_EQUAL
address
34bGx4AxpmKYoVb1pwfpQcixuYnzDCQJ26
transaction
17a4bffdfd4e4b82184fd121c620157c251b137fa842811bc3030ee3bf798f01
confirmations
315174
spent
true